Transaction 21b18c36978e08fdf4f5245ff4fd776663761de31a480240beabaf40d0357620
1 Input
1 Output
-
21b18c36978e08fdf4f5245ff4fd776663761de31a480240beabaf40d0357620:0
- value
- 10004328
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 051806416904f39adec11d518773c70835f8daf6 OP_EQUAL
- address
- 329x5kT6fpgtsX7hd4PLFmMSi8Z3wFELuF